TVI Concentrating On Philippines Gold Mine

TVI Resource Development (Philippines) Inc., a unit of TVI Pacific Inc. of Canada, is looking at the Balabag gold prospect in Zamboanga del Sur as its next priority mining project.

TVI Resource said the Balabag mining property had the potential to become the company’s second production center based on initial exploration results.

TVI Resource has begun to evaluate options to bring the Balabag project into production, with advance development work scheduled to commence later this year.

A company official who declined to be named said initial work on the mine could follow with a minimum initial capital.

The company has begun construction of an additional flotation circuit to process zinc ore at its Canatuan mine in Siocon, Zamboanga del Norte province.

“As we mine through the copper rich portion of the ore body and start getting into the copper-zinc zone as expected, the ability to separate and monetize the zinc will result in additional revenue,” said chief executive Cliff James earlier.

“This will allow us to further accelerate two key target areas of our growth strategy, which include exploration and development activities at Canatuan and Balabag, and exploration projects at Tamarok,” he added.

Construction of the zinc circuit began on Oct. 28, or three months ahead of schedule. It is expected to be fully operational by late April next year.
